What is the difference between Working Service Manager vs Service Coordinator?

AspectWorking Service ManagerService Coordinator
CredentialsRelevant certifications, experience in service managementCustomer service certifications, administrative skills
Work EnvironmentOversees service teams, manages operationsCoordinates service appointments, communicates with clients
Employer & IndustryService industries like HVAC, IT, facilities managementCustomer service departments, support centers

The Working Service Manager typically has more responsibilities in managing service teams and operations, requiring specific management experience and certifications. In contrast, a Service Coordinator focuses on scheduling, client communication, and supporting service delivery. Both roles are essential in service industries but differ in scope and seniority.

What does a working service manager do?

A working service manager oversees the delivery of services within an organization, ensuring customer satisfaction and efficient operations. They coordinate teams, manage schedules, resolve issues, and often use tools like CRM systems to monitor performance and improve service quality.

Job description

Overview

At HomeTeam we put people first. We make sure at HomeTeam you have the tools, support, and training they need to deliver a delightful experience to every customer. Our friendly, warm work environment means great work gets recognized and rewarded. If you take pride in going above and beyond to make a customer smile, you could be HomeTeam’s next all-star player.

Responsibilities
  • Ensure daily assigned revenue is completed
  • Maintain a high level of service quality
  • Standardize pest control technician service routes to improve route density
  • Schedule and review daily routes with technicians
  • Handle customer complaints; investigate and resolve customer service concerns
  • Assist technicians with field service requests and delinquent accounts
  • Order and maintain equipment, supplies and materials required for service work
  • Create a positive work environment
  • Attract and select high caliber employees, while maintaining qualified staff
  • Actively manage performance and motivate service staff
  • Follow and enforce work procedures, prepare work schedules, and expedite workflow to subordinates
  • Maintain appropriate certification/licensing as required by the state or by branch management
  • Coordinate training and licensing of new and existing service personnel
  • Coordinate and/or provide continuing training as needed
  • Maintain truck inventory records and perform periodic inspections
  • Delegate duties and examine work for accuracy and neatness
  • Maintain record of all commercial vehicle licenses and pest control licenses
  • Assist General/Branch Manager in other duties assigned
  • Work weekends as necessary to assist the technicians
  • Performs all necessary supervisory functions to effectively and efficiently manage the personnel assigned.
